Shownotes
In this episode, Chandra and Paul discuss key updates impacting JD Edwards customers, focusing on Critical Security Patch Updates (CSPUs) and the transition from 32-bit to 64-bit architecture. The conversation explores the reasons behind the shift to monthly CSPUs, including enhanced security in light of rapid AI advancements, and clarifies how patches are delivered, their cumulative nature, and what these changes mean for customers on older releases or 32-bit systems. They provide guidance for those behind on updates, touch on the challenges and misconceptions surrounding migration to 64-bit, and stress the importance of regular maintenance and planning to stay current.
